CVE-2007-4456 describes a SQL injection vulnerability in the SimpleFAQ component (com_simplefaq) for Mambo, specifically versions 2.11 and 2.40, which also affects Joomla! installations. This flaw allows unauthenticated rem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ands through the 'aid' parameter in index.php. With a CVSS score of 7.5, this vulnerability is considered highly severe due to its network-based attack vector and low attack complexity, potentially leading to partial comp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ability. While not listed on the KEV catalog, public exploit code is available via ExploitDB, though there is no indication of active exploitation or significant community discussion.
